1

Senior C Python Developer Jobs in Chicago, IL (NOW HIRING)

Senior Snowflake Developer

Chicago Heights, IL ยท On-site

$118.40K - $159.30K/yr

Develop data transformation logic using Snowflake SQL, stored procedures, and Python. * Collaborate ... Partner with DevOps teams to implement CI/CD practices for data pipeline deployments. Required ...

They are looking for outstanding Senior Software Engineers with an expertise in C++. In this role ... Have significant experience developing high-availability systems in C++ and Python with very tight ...

Java Developer w/ Python or Perl Location: Chicago, IL Position Type: Contract Unfortunately, we ... C, Java or Go. -Network and system administration skills are a big plus. -Our client primarily ...

Location(s) Alpharetta, Georgia, P&C-Butterfield Road-Downers Grove-IL-AAC, St. Louis, Missouri ... Leadership: Lead a team of engineers, fostering a culture of innovation, collaboration and ...

Role Overview We are seeking an experienced Senior Full Stack Software Engineer to lead development ... Python (including pseudocode and transitional code understanding) * Hands-on experience with: * API ...

next page

Showing results 1-20

Senior C Python Developer information

See Chicago, IL salary details

$56.7K

$146.3K

$200.9K

How much do senior c python developer jobs pay per year?

As of May 31, 2026, the average yearly pay for senior c python developer in Chicago, IL is $146,255.00, according to ZipRecruiter salary data. Most workers in this role earn between $125,200.00 and $168,400.00 per year, depending on experience, location, and employer.

What is the difference between Senior C Python Developer vs Software Engineer?

AspectSenior C Python DeveloperSoftware Engineer
Required CredentialsBachelor's in Computer Science or related, experience in C and PythonBachelor's or higher in Computer Science or related, general programming skills
Work EnvironmentTech companies, R&D labs, embedded systemsVaried industries including tech, finance, healthcare
Industry UsageEmbedded systems, high-performance computing, data processingApplication development, system design, software solutions

While both roles require strong programming skills in C and Python, the Senior C Python Developer focuses more on embedded systems and performance-critical applications, whereas a Software Engineer has a broader scope across various software development projects.

What are the most commonly searched types of C Python Developer jobs in Chicago, IL? The most popular types of C Python Developer jobs in Chicago, IL are:
Senior Snowflake Developer

Senior Snowflake Developer

Numentica LLC

Chicago Heights, IL โ€ข On-site

$118.40K - $159.30K/yr

Contractor

Posted 9 days ago


Job description

Job Description
Key Responsibilities
  • Design, develop, and maintain scalable data pipelines using Snowflake as the core data warehouse platform.
  • Build and optimize batch, file-based, and real-time streaming data ingestion processes from multiple sources.
  • Develop data transformation logic using Snowflake SQL, stored procedures, and Python.
  • Collaborate with architects, analysts, and business teams to translate requirements into technical solutions.
  • Monitor and troubleshoot pipeline performance while ensuring data quality and availability.
  • Maintain documentation for data flows, models, and system architecture.
  • Partner with DevOps teams to implement CI/CD practices for data pipeline deployments.
Required Skills and Experience
  • Bachelor's degree in Computer Science, Information Systems, or related field.
  • 5+ years of experience in data engineering or similar roles.
  • 3+ years of strong hands-on experience with Snowflake, including advanced SQL, stored procedures, and performance tuning.
  • Experience with data ingestion methods such as bulk loading, micro-batching, and streaming.
  • Strong knowledge of AWS services such as S3, Lambda, and CloudWatch, or Azure services including Data Factory, Event Hubs, Blob Storage, and Azure Functions.
  • Experience in using Terraform to provision and manage infrastructure, including Snowflake resources or cloud environments.
  • Experience working in Azure cloud environments.
  • Strong Python programming skills for automation, integrations, and data processing.
  • Good experience with SQL Server and relational databases.
  • Knowledge of data modeling, security, governance, and best practices.
  • Experience with Git and collaborative development environments.